GUNT Groundwater Flow Trainer, 3D Sand Tank, Open-Seam Tube Wells, Excavation Pit Simulation, Manometer Display

The GUNT Groundwater Flow Trainer enables three-dimensional investigations of subsurface water movement, supporting education and research in hydrology and geotechnical engineering. With a sand-filled tank, interchangeable models, and dual well/tube systems, this unit offers realistic simulation of groundwater extraction and flow through soils.

Product Features

  • Designed for studying groundwater extraction from wells and excavation pits
  • Sand-filled tank for realistic simulation of soil and groundwater interaction
  • Supports 3D visualization and analysis of groundwater flow principles
  • Two horizontal open-seam tubes supply water; each controlled by separate valves
  • Flexible water input configuration allows diverse flow simulations
  • Two individually valved wells with open-seam tubes for extracting groundwater
  • Three removable excavation pit models simulate real-world drainage and construction scenarios
  • Orthogonally arranged measuring ports at the tank bottom for precise groundwater level detection
  • Groundwater levels displayed via 19 tube manometers for clear monitoring
